Popular places to visit

Saginaw Valley State University
Enjoy the collegiate vibe when you visit Saginaw Valley State University, during your trip to Saginaw. Stroll along the area's riverfront or simply enjoy its bars.

Temple Theatre
Visit downtown Saginaw’s stunningly refurbished event hall to catch a film or to watch a performance of music or drama.

Hoyt Park
A Saginaw favorite, this historic park has for decades been hosting baseball games in summer and outdoor ice-skating in winter.

Marshall M. Fredericks Sculpture Museum
Delve into the unique vision of one of America’s favorite sculptors at this dedicated museum and sculpture garden on a university campus.

Shiawassee National Wildlife Refuge
You can take time to visit Shiawassee National Wildlife Refuge during your travels to Saginaw. Attend a sporting event or visit the shops in this family-friendly area.

Ojibway Island
Saginaw’s scenic island park offers a lovely setting for outdoor recreation, lakeside relaxation and a wide range of special events.
